Usage Scenarios
Crotonyl chloride (CAS: 10487-71-5) finds applications in various industries, including:
- Chemical Synthesis: Crotonyl chloride is used as an intermediate in the synthesis of pharmaceuticals, agrochemicals, and fine chemicals.
- Plastic Industry: It is used as a monomer in the production of certain types of plastics.
- Paints and Coatings: Crotonyl chloride is used as a modifier in paints and coatings to improve their properties.

FAQs
Here are some frequently asked questions about crotonyl chloride (CAS: 10487-71-5):
- Q: Is crotonyl chloride flammable?
- A: Yes, crotonyl chloride is flammable. It has a flash point of 60°C, so it is essential to handle it with caution.
- Q: Can crotonyl chloride be used in food and beverage applications?
- A: No, crotonyl chloride is not suitable for use in food and beverage applications due to its potential health risks.
- Q: What are the health hazards associated with crotonyl chloride exposure?
- A: Exposure to crotonyl chloride can cause irritation to the eyes, skin, and respiratory system. Long-term exposure may lead to more severe health issues.
